Granny's Noodles

1 1/4 cups all purpose flour
3 tablespoons melted margarine
2 eggs
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on baking powder

Mix, roll, cut (this was my grandma's description! ) These noodles do not have to dry, you can cut them and throw them right into the boiling broth, or you can let them sit a while, it doesn't matter. I cut these noodles very thin, cause they do puff up when cooked.
